Just a random article that I found lurking on the web. This is just so true:

"In <1992Mar21.023720.4152@acsu.buffalo.edu> leet@acsu.buffalo.edu (Brian D. Leet) writes:

"Older muds" are more "enjoyable" for the simple reason that the most
chattering bunch on the net these days started playing sometime back
then (in the "good ol' days"). When you're ignorant of the coding ways
of the muds, you view everything as "magical", thus more enjoyable and
entertaining (IMHO

I can still remember the first mud I logged on and a wiz popped into the
room. The rush that I got from watching him cloning items (not in those
specific terms of course can never be forgotten. When you know how
the codings work, the "magic" is then all gone.
